David Hayter didn't really have a great run with his most recent screenwriting effort, Watchmen, but the experienced screenwriter is confidently going ahead with his next venture, forming Dark Hero Studios with producer Benedict Carver.
The goal of the studio, according to Variety, will be to create all kinds of sci-if, action and horror projects for film, TV, Internet and video games. First up for the two of them will be Slaughter's Road, Hayter's directorial debut, which will be a werewolf thriller starring Sarah Connor Chronicles actor Thomas Dekker.
Hayter also had a few words for those who are willing to write off Watchmen as a failure, just over a week into its run. "It's odd for a picture to gross $63 million in its first four days and have people wonder if it's a failure." Regardless of how you want to classify Watchmen, it's a smart move for Hayter to get moving on his own projects, rather than tying his fate to giant superhero movies with a limited margin for success.
